The Putter Quiz Has Officially Ended!

Wow!  what a contest.  I honestly am still surprised by the number of comments and entries we get to our quizzes.  It started off slow but I thought it would since this one took some major research if you wanted to win…but it ended with a major rush of entries.  Overall between the blog, Facebook, Twitter and email we got over 250 entries.  And here are our winners:

1. 15 out of 15 ($250 Cash Prize) – No surprise that no one guessed all 15 on their first attempt but still some very good first attempts nonetheless.
2. Most Correct (Slotline Putter) – Jon Phelps got 15 out of 15 on his 6th and final try and won the Slotline putter with the most correct answers.
3. Most Referrals ($50 Cash Prize) – FunkyFedora referred the most people to the contest and won a $50 cash prize!
4. First to guess the Scotty Cameron (RoboCup) – Todd Bailey, even though it had a ? mark by it lol.
5. First to guess the real Ping Anser (Mibrella) – GolferBurnz…it was tough between the last three but he got it right.

The Correct Answers

Some of you guys put some major time and effort in to this quiz so I am sure you would like to now see the correct answers.  This time I will post the photos but WITHOUT the BLUR over the name and model.  We got some hilarious emails about how differently some of you guys are going to look at copy-cat Anser style designs from now on.  And that was one point of the quiz…to make you guys aware of the type of insanity that sometimes goes on over one of these designs.  A perfect example is the new Nike Method Anser style putter.  I don’t remember a time where there was more hype over a putter that looked almost identical to a putter that has been done so many times before.
